DataGridViewHeaderCell::GetInheritedState Method (Int32)
Returns a value indicating the current state of the cell as inherited from the state of its row or column.
Assembly: System.Windows.Forms (in System.Windows.Forms.dll)
Parameters
- rowIndex
-
Type:
System::Int32
The index of the row containing the cell or -1 if the cell is not a row header cell or is not contained within a DataGridView control.
Return Value
Type: System.Windows.Forms::DataGridViewElementStatesA bitwise combination of DataGridViewElementStates values representing the current state of the cell.
| Exception | Condition |
|---|---|
| ArgumentException | The cell is a row header cell, the cell is not contained within a DataGridView control, and rowIndex is not -1. - or - The cell is a row header cell, the cell is contained within a DataGridView control, and rowIndex is outside the valid range of 0 to the number of rows in the control minus 1. - or - The cell is a row header cell and rowIndex is not the index of the row containing this cell. |
| ArgumentOutOfRangeException | The cell is a column header cell or the control's TopLeftHeaderCell and rowIndex is not -1. |
Available since 2.0